Oral formulation of lipid soluble thiamine, lipoic acid, creatine derivative, and L-arginine alpha-ketoglutarate
A formulation comprised of four active components which are a lipid soluble thiamine, lipoic acid, arginine α-ketoglutarate, and a creatine derivative for oral administration is disclosed. The active components may be combined with excipient materials in such a way that those materials provide for an immediate release of a first portion of the active ingredients from the formulation following by a gradual release of any remaining active ingredients in a manner which makes it possible to (1) quickly obtain a therapeutic level of the active ingredients; and (2) substantially increase the period of time over which therapeutic levels of the active ingredients are maintained relative to a quick release formulation. These features make it possible to use the formulation to obtain a range of beneficial effects including reducing serum glucose levels and maintaining those reduced glucose levels over time to treat diabetic polyneuropathy as well as improving circulation and increasing muscle performance.
